JBT to purchase LEKTRO

JBT Corporation of Chicago reached an agreement to acquire LEKTRO Inc., which focuses on the design, manufacture, and supply of all-electric towbarless tow and pushback vehicles for the business jet and commercial aviation market.

JBT operates as an airport equipment company through its JBT AeroTech division and, through its FoodTech segment, also holds a major presence in the design, production and servicing of products and automated systems for the food processing industry.

“We are excited to be part of JBT,” said Eric Paulson, owner of LEKTRO. “Together our companies will provide customers a global sales and support presence, a much broader portfolio of products and services, and deeper engineering capabilities for future product development.” Located in Warrenton, Oregon, LEKTRO will join with JBT AeroTech’s GSE business unit.

JBT describes LEKTRO’s family of all-electric towbarless vehicles as a great complement to JBT AeroTech’s expanding line-up of diesel tow tractors and other Ground Support Equipment (GSE) products. This GSE segment includes de-icers, cargo loaders, belt loaders, mobile stairs, pre-conditioned air carts, and ground power units.

“LEKTRO’s reputation for great customer service and products that are easy to operate, easy to maintain, and highly reliable makes it an ideal fit for JBT AeroTech,” said Dave Burdakin, EVP and president of JBT AeroTech.
